1. Mitte: The Historical Heart of Berlin
If you’re looking to immerse yourself in Berlin’s historical and cultural heritage, Mitte should be at the top of your list. This central district is home to many iconic landmarks, including the Brandenburg Gate, Museum Island, and the Berlin Wall Memorial. The area also offers a wide range of accommodations, from luxury hotels to cozy guesthouses.

2. Kreuzberg: The Bohemian Oasis
Kreuzberg is known for its vibrant arts scene, multicultural atmosphere, and lively nightlife. This neighborhood attracts a diverse crowd, from artists and musicians to students and young professionals. Staying in Kreuzberg means you’ll be surrounded by trendy cafes, street art, and a buzzing street market.

3. Prenzlauer Berg: Family-Friendly and Hip
Prenzlauer Berg is a popular neighborhood among families and young professionals. With its picturesque streets, green parks, and cozy cafes, it offers a pleasant and relaxed atmosphere. This area is also known for its vibrant nightlife, boutique shops, and the iconic Kulturbrauerei complex.

4. Charlottenburg: Elegance and Serenity
Located in the western part of Berlin, Charlottenburg is known for its upscale charm, palaces, and wide boulevards. This neighborhood offers a quieter and more serene environment, yet it’s still within reach of popular attractions such as Charlottenburg Palace and the famous Ku’Damm shopping street.
